The Narrative

This certified original work reinterprets Michelangelo's Moses using 19th-century Florentine academic techniques. Created in October 2018 by Agustín Rüdegar, it stands as a testament to rigorous observation and classical discipline.

The challenge was not just to copy a statue, but to translate the cold marble of Michelangelo into the warmth of charcoal. Every fold of the fabric, every strand of the beard, required a study of light and shadow that pushed my technical capabilities to the limit.

This work currently resides in a private collection in Bergen, Norway. It represents the culmination of my academic training in the sight-size method.

"It was difficult, but I think it was worth it. After six months of work, the stone became paper."
